This is definitely good advice, if you can also ensure that most, if not all water flows through this point then you can maximise the pressure and therefore the power output. The waterwheels have resistance so the water will take the path of least resistance and just flow around it instead of under it, 2 things you can do is use a bunch of the smaller wheels, or force the water under the wheel by building levees to force the water to do what you want. The best placement in a river is one in front of the other with the river blocked up to 1 wheel wide and a drop-off/deeper area on the water exit side of the wheel to drain it faster, or a wider river on the other side, same thing to drain it faster.
